Hi Gals, I have had some experience with this, as a lot of ladies on the board here have, so hopefully they will chime in too.

A benign and totally normal ovarian cyst can cause all the symptoms you are talking about. I had the same thing a few years back. My GYN felt that one ovary was a bit enlarged and sent me for an ultrasound. She told me from the beginning that she didn't feel that it was anything serious, that she just wanted it looked at. By the time I had it done, the one they were looking for was gone, and had one on the other ovary.  :spineyes: Actually, cysts form every month on the ovaries at ovulation, most of the time, though, they don't grow and disappear so we don't know they are there.
As for the Dr. checking and not thinking you need an ultrasound, GYNs are very experienced in this, enough so that they know if anything about the ovary feels different and what it may mean. A totally normal feeling ovary wouldn't be possibly cancerous and that is what he/she is going by. So, take your Dr's word!
